Linux原始碼的編譯安裝

2021-07-16 14:41:34 字數 611 閱讀 1151

1、檢查編譯器是否安裝

gcc --version

2、解壓原始碼包

tar -xzf nginx-1.8.1.tar.gz

3、進入解壓好的原始碼目錄

cd nginx-1.8.1.tar.gz

4、執行configure檔案,設定和檢查編譯引數

./configure --prefix=/usr/local/nginx --conf-path=/etc/nginx/nginx.conf

--prefix制定安裝路徑,--conf-path制定配置檔案位置

./configure --help檢視詳細引數說明

5、執行make命令,編譯程式

make

6、編譯成功後執行安裝

make install

參考:

linux 原始碼編譯安裝

tar.gz tar.bz2 的是源 包,需要編譯之後才能安裝,在編譯過程中你可以指定各種引數以適應你的系統需求,比如安裝位置,優化引數,要哪些功能不要哪些功能等等。這類源 包需要解壓後 tar.gz 的用tar zxvf 解壓,tar.bz2 的用tar jxvf 解壓 進入解壓目錄,一般都有乙個...

linux原始碼編譯安裝redis

系統環境 ubuntu 14.04.1 lts x64 tar xvf redis 3.0.0 rc1.tar.gz c usr local 進入到 usr local redis 3.0.0 rc1 目錄,執行 make 修改daemonize 改為 yes 使其能在後台執行服務 bind 改為 ...

Linux 原始碼編譯安裝apache

建議先閱讀全文,再開始操作,按照正確的順序會省事很多!configure 這裡可以自己指定路徑 報錯 找不到apr 也就是依賴,要先安裝apr 安裝apr步驟見後文 安裝好apr相關的包後,繼續回到cd httpd 2.4.43 configure with apr usr local apr ap...